@font-face {
	font-family: DIN-Light;
	src: local("DIN-Light"), url(../font/DIN-Light.eot) format("embedded-opentype"), url(../font/DIN-Light.otf) format("opentype"), url(../font/DIN-Light.woff) format("woff"), url(../font/DIN-Light.ttf) format("truetype");
}
@font-face {
	font-family: DINSchrift;
	src: local("DINSchrift"), url(../font/DINEngschrift.eot) format("embedded-opentype"), url(../font/DINEngschrift.otf) format("opentype"), url(../font/DINEngschrift.woff) format("woff"), url(../font/DINEngschrift.ttf) format("truetype");
}
@font-face {
	font-family: DINPro-Regular;
	src: local("DINPro-Regular"), url(../font/DINPro-Regular.eot) format("embedded-opentype"), url(../font/DINPro-Regular.otf) format("opentype"), url(../font/DINPro-Regular.woff) format("woff"), url(../font/DINPro-Regular.ttf) format("truetype");
}
@font-face {
	font-family: DINPro-Medium;
	src: local("DINPro-Medium"), url(../font/DINPro-Medium.eot) format("embedded-opentype"), url(../font/DINPro-Medium.otf) format("opentype"), url(../font/DINPro-Medium.woff) format("woff"), url(../font/DINPro-Medium.ttf) format("truetype");
}
html {
	height: 100%;
}
body {
	margin: 0px auto; padding: 0px; color: rgb(143, 211, 245); font-family: "DINPro-Regular",Helvetica, Arial; font-size: 100%; background-color: rgb(255, 255, 255);
}
ul {
	list-style: none; margin: 0px; padding: 0px;
}
li {
	list-style: none; margin: 0px; padding: 0px;
}
img {
	margin: 0px; padding: 0px; border: 0px currentColor; display: block;
}
p {
	margin: 0px; padding: 0px; border: 0px currentColor; display: block;
}
.fleft {
	float: left;
}
.fright {
	float: right;
}
.clearn {
	clear: both;
}
.line {
	margin: 15px 0px; border-top-color: rgb(0, 91, 172); border-top-width: 1px; border-top-style: solid;
}
.HeadLayer {
	margin: 0px auto; width: 75%; position: relative; max-width: 1440px; background-color: rgb(255, 255, 255);
}
.MainLayer {
	margin: 0px auto; width: 75%; position: relative; max-width: 1440px; background-color: rgb(255, 255, 255);
}
.logoDiv {
	width: 51.53%; margin-bottom: 5px; position: relative;
}
.logoDiv img {
	width: 100%; margin-top: 9%;
}
.navDiv {
	text-align: right; padding-top: 5px; padding-bottom: 15px;
}
.navDiv img {
	width: 100%;
}
.navDiv ul {
	width: 98%;
}
.navDiv li {
	width: 14%; text-align: center; display: inline-block;
}
.navDiv a {
	color: rgb(0, 148, 255); text-decoration: none;
}
.navDiv .Current {
	background: url("../images/navbj.png") no-repeat center / 100%;
}
.bottomBlk {
	width: 100%; height: 1%; min-height: 10px; max-height: 15px;
}
.footer {
	margin: 15px auto auto; width: 75%; height: 25px; text-align: center; color: rgb(102, 102, 102); line-height: 25px; font-size: 9pt; position: relative;
}
.footer span {
	margin: 0px 10px; display: inline-block;
}
.footer img {
	vertical-align: middle; display: inline-block;
}
.footer .BeiAn {
	padding-right: 5px; float: right;
}
.footer .PowerBy {
	padding-left: 5px;
}
.mob {
	display: none;
}
.turnpage {
	left: 7%; top: 45%; width: 86%; position: fixed;
}
.turnpage .left {
	float: left;
}
.turnpage .right {
	float: right;
}
.Carousel > img {
	left: 0px; top: 0px; display: none; position: relative;
}
.Carousel_m > img {
	left: 0px; top: 0px; display: none; position: relative;
}
.Thumbnail {
	width: 100%; text-align: center; bottom: 3em; color: rgb(255, 255, 255); position: absolute; z-index: 9999;
}
.Thumbnail_m {
	width: 100%; text-align: center; bottom: 3em; color: rgb(255, 255, 255); position: absolute; z-index: 9999;
}
.Thumbnail li {
	margin: 0px 5px; width: 1em; font-size: 2em; display: inline-block;
}
.Thumbnail_m li {
	margin: 0px 5px; width: 1em; font-size: 2em; display: inline-block;
}
.Thumbnail li a {
	color: inherit; text-decoration: none;
}
.Thumbnail_m li a {
	color: inherit; text-decoration: none;
}
.Thumbnail li a.on {
	font-size: 1.2em;
}
.Thumbnail_m li a.on {
	font-size: 1.2em;
}
.ContentDiv {
	width: 100%; position: relative;
}
.ContentDiv img {
	width: 100%;
}
.ContentDiv_m {
	width: 100%; display: none; position: relative;
}
.ContentDiv_m img {
	width: 100%;
}
.Container {
	left: 0px; top: 0px; width: 100%; position: absolute;
}
.Brief {
	width: 56.25%; margin-right: 10%; float: right;
}
.PageTitle {
	width: 56.25%; margin-right: 10%; float: right;
}
.PageTitle {
	text-align: right; letter-spacing: 0.2em; padding-top: 4%; padding-bottom: 2%; font-family:Arial, Helvetica, sans-serif; font-size: 2em;
}
.Brief {
	text-align: justify; line-height: 1.8em; font-family:Arial, Helvetica, sans-serif; font-size: 1em;}
.Brief p {
	padding-top: 0.8em; padding-bottom: 0.8em;
}
.Brief b {
	line-height: 1.5em; font-size: 1.2em;
}
.WhatDirectory {
	width: 22%; right: 10%; color: rgb(0, 91, 172); line-height: 1.8em; font-size:1.1em; margin-top: 8%; float: right; position: relative;
}
.WhatDirectory .PhaseTitle {
	line-height: 1em; padding-bottom: 10%; font-family:Arial, Helvetica, sans-serif; font-size: 1.6em;
}
.WhatDirectory a {
	color: rgb(0, 91, 172); text-decoration: none;
}
.WhereDiv {
	color: rgb(255, 255, 255);
}
.WhereInput {
	margin: auto; width: 90%; color: rgb(0, 91, 172); padding-top: 3%;
}
.WhereInput .WhereTitle {
	font-family:Arial, Helvetica, sans-serif; font-size: 2em;
}
.WhereInput input {
	margin: 1% 0px; border: 1px solid rgb(0, 91, 172); width: 100%; height: 32px; color: rgb(0, 91, 172); line-height: 32px;
}
.WhereInput input[name='username'] {
	width: 45%; margin-right: 9%;
}
.WhereInput input[name='email'] {
	width: 45%;
}
.WhereInput textarea {
	margin: 1% 0px; border: 1px solid rgb(0, 91, 172); width: 100%; color: rgb(0, 91, 172); line-height: 32px; font-family: "DINPro-Regular";
}
.WhereInput a {
	background: url("../images/send.png") no-repeat; width: 200px; height: 82px; display: block;
}
.ProcuctDiv {
	margin: 0px 5px; position: relative;
}
.ProcuctDiv .productpic {
	width: 56%; float: left;
}
.ProcuctDiv .productpic img {
	width: 100%;
}
.ProcuctDiv .productpic_m {
	display: none;
}
.ProcuctDiv .productpic_m img {
	width: 100%;
}
.ProcuctDiv .Introduction {
	top: 0px; width: 41.4%; right: 5px; bottom: 0px; color: rgb(0, 0, 0); border-top-color: rgb(0, 91, 172); border-bottom-color: rgb(0, 91, 172); border-top-width: 3px; border-bottom-width: 3px; border-top-style: solid; border-bottom-style: solid; position: absolute; box-shadow: 3px 3px 5px #666;
}
.ProcuctDiv .Introduction .TextDiv {
	margin: auto; width: 95%;
}
.ProcuctDiv .Introduction img {
	width: 22%;
}
.ProcuctDiv .Introduction p {
	margin:4% auto;; line-height: 1.1em;padding-left: 1em; text-indent: -0.7em; font-size: 0.9em;
}
.ProcuctDiv .Introduction b {
	padding-bottom: 3px; display: block;
}
.ProcuctDiv .Introduction h3 {
	margin: 0.5em auto; text-align: left; color: rgb(0, 91, 172); font-size: 2em;
}
.ProcuctDiv .Iconright {
	background: url("../images/product_1.png") no-repeat 5% 95% / 25%;
}
.ProcuctDiv .Iconleft {
	background: url("../images/product_5.png") no-repeat 95% 95% / 25%;
}
.ProcuctDiv .IconleftTop {
	background: url("../images/product_5.png") no-repeat 95% 5% / 25%;
}
.Packaging .Iconleft {
	background-image: url("../images/product_2.png");
}
.Speciality .Introduction p {
	text-indent: 0em; padding-left: 0em;
}
.Tissue .Introduction p {
	margin: 3% auto;
}
.WhyContext {
	margin: auto; padding: 5% 0px; width: 77%; color: rgb(0, 91, 172); line-height: 1.5em; font-size: 1em;
}
.WhyContext p {
	padding: 0.8% 0px;
}
.WhyContext b {
	font-size: 1.2em; text-decoration: underline;
}
.WhyContext .WhyTitle {
	margin: 1em 0px; font-family:Arial, Helvetica, sans-serif; font-size: 1.7em;
}
.Whybj {
	background-image: url("../images/whybk.jpg");
}
@media screen and (max-width:1440px)
{
.Brief {
	width: 57%; line-height: 1.1em; font-size: 0.9em;
}
.Tissue .Introduction p {
	margin: 2% auto;
}
.Speciality .Introduction p {
	margin: 2% auto;
}
.Tissue .line {
	margin: 10px 0px;
}
.Speciality .line {
	margin: 10px 0px;
}
}
@media screen and (max-width:1366px)
{
.Brief {
	width: 60%; line-height: 1.15em; font-size: 0.9em;
}
.Brief p {
	padding: 0.4em 0px;
}
.WhatDirectory {
	width: 19%;
}
.WhatDirectory .PhaseTitle {
	font-size: 1.9em;
}
.Speciality .Introduction p {
	margin: 1.3% auto; line-height: 1.15em; font-size: 0.9em;
}
.Speciality .line {
	margin: 10px 0px;
}
.Tissue .Introduction p {
	margin: 1.6% auto;
}
.Tissue .line {
	margin: 10px 0px;
}
}
@media screen and (max-width:1024px)
{
.line {
	margin: 5px 0px;
}
.PageTitle {
	padding-top: 2%; padding-bottom: 1%; font-size: 1.8em;
}
.Brief {
	left: 20%; width: 70%; font-size: 0.8em;
}
.Brief p {
	padding: 0.4em 0px;
}
.WhatDirectory {
	width: 41%;
}
.WhatDirectory .PhaseTitle {
	font-size: 1.8em;
}
.ProcuctDiv .Introduction p {
	margin: 4% auto; text-indent: -0.9em; padding-left: 1em; font-size: 0.9em;
}
.ProcuctDiv .Introduction b {
	padding-bottom: 3px; display: block;
}
.ProcuctDiv .Introduction h3 {
	margin: 0.5em auto; text-align: left; color: rgb(0, 91, 172); font-size: 1.7em;
}
.Speciality .Introduction {
	bottom: auto;
}
.Tissue .Introduction {
	bottom: auto;
}
.Speciality .Introduction p {
	margin: 2% auto; font-size: 0.9em;
}
.Tissue .Introduction p {
	margin: 1.6% auto;
}
.Packaging .Introduction p {
	margin: 2% auto;
}
}
@media screen and (max-width:800px)
{
.HeadLayer {
	width: 100%;
}
.MainLayer {
	width: 100%;
}
.turnpage {
	display: none;
}
.PageTitle {
	font-size: 1.7em;
}
.Brief {
	line-height: 1em; font-size: 0.8em;
}
.Brief p {
	padding: 0.3em 0px;
}
.WhyContext {
	width: 90%;
}
.ProcuctDiv .Introduction p {
	margin: 4% auto; text-indent: -0.8em; padding-left: 1em; font-size: 0.8em;
}
.ProcuctDiv .Introduction b {
	padding-bottom: 3px; display: block;
}
.ProcuctDiv .Introduction h3 {
	margin: 0.5em auto; text-align: left; color: rgb(0, 91, 172); font-size: 2em;
}
.Speciality .Introduction {
	bottom: auto;
}
.Speciality .Introduction p {
	margin: 2% auto; font-size: 0.9em;
}
.Tissue .Introduction p {
	margin: 2% auto;
}
}
@media screen and (max-width:640px)
{
.HeadLayer {
	max-width: 640px;
}
.logoDiv {
	width: 85%; margin-right: auto; margin-left: auto;
}
.navDiv {
	text-align: center; padding-top: 5px; padding-bottom: 5px;
}
.navDiv ul {
	margin: auto; width: 98%;
}
.navDiv li {
	width: 17%;
}
.ContentDiv {
	display: none;
}
.ContentDiv_m {
	display: block;
}
.PageTitle {
	letter-spacing: 0.1em; padding-top: 8%; padding-bottom: 2%; font-size: 1.5em;
}
.Brief {
	line-height: 1.2em; font-size: 0.7em;
}
.Brief p {
	padding-top: 0.7em; padding-bottom: 0.5em;
}
.WhyContext {
	margin: auto; font-size: 0.8em;
}
.WhyContext p {
	padding: 0.8% 0px;
}
.WhyContext .WhyTitle {
	margin: 1em 0px; text-align: center; font-family:Arial, Helvetica, sans-serif;font-size: 1.7em;
}
.WhereInput input[name='username'] {
	width: 100%; margin-right: 0px;
}
.WhereInput input[name='email'] {
	width: 100%;
}
.WhereInput a {
	background: url("../images/send_m.png") no-repeat; width: 89px; height: 36px; display: block;
}
.WhatDirectory {
	width: 40%; font-size: 1em;
}
.WhatDirectory .PhaseTitle {
	font-size: 1.7em;
}
.Thumbnail_m {
	bottom: 2em;
}
.Thumbnail_m li {
	font-size: 1em;
}
.ProcuctDiv .productpic {
	display: none;
}
.ProcuctDiv .productpic_m {
	width: 43%; display: block;
}
.ProcuctDiv .Introduction {
	width: 54%;
}
.ProcuctDiv .Introduction img {
	width: 35%;
}
.ProcuctDiv .Introduction p {
	margin: 4% auto; text-indent: -0.8em; padding-left: 1em; font-size: 0.8em;
}
.ProcuctDiv .Introduction b {
	padding-bottom: 3px; display: block;
}
.ProcuctDiv .Introduction h3 {
	margin: 0.5em auto; text-align: left; color: rgb(0, 91, 172); font-size: 1.5em;
}
.Speciality .Introduction {
	bottom: auto;
}
.Tissue .Introduction {
	bottom: auto;
}
.Uncoated .Introduction {
	bottom: auto;
}
.Speciality .Introduction p {
	margin: 2% auto; font-size: 0.9em;
}
.Tissue .Introduction p {
	margin: 2% auto;
}
.pc {
	display: none;
}
.mob {
	display: block;
}
.footer {
	display: none;
}
}
@media screen and (max-width:375px)
{
.ProcuctDiv .productpic {
	display: none;
}
.ProcuctDiv .productpic_m {
	width: 43%; display: block;
}
.ProcuctDiv .Introduction {
	width: 54%;
}
.ProcuctDiv .Introduction img {
	width: 35%;
}
.ProcuctDiv .Introduction p {
	margin: 4% auto; text-indent: -0.7em; padding-left: 1em; font-size: 0.7em;
}
.ProcuctDiv .Introduction b {
	padding-bottom: 3px; display: block;
}
.ProcuctDiv .Introduction h3 {
	margin: 0.5em auto; text-align: left; color: rgb(0, 91, 172); font-size: 1em;
}
.Speciality .Introduction p {
	
}
.Speciality .Introduction .line {
	margin: 5px 0px;
}
.Speciality .Introduction h3 {
	margin: 0.4em auto;
}
.Tissue .Introduction p {
	margin: 1.1% auto; line-height: 1em; font-size: 0.7em;
}
.Tissue .Introduction h3 {
	margin: 0.4em auto;
}
.Tissue .Introduction .line {
	margin: 4px 0px;
}
.Packaging .Introduction {
	bottom: auto;
}
}
